Sponsored Content While meeting with a Grant and Susan* a few weeks ago, we were reviewing their spending and one of the biggest items was the amount they were spending on their daughter’s rent. To be fair, their daughter was in second year university in a pandemic, but this rent payment was going to be a big component affecting when Grant and Susan could retire. So, I pointed out that she had a lot more time to pay down a debt gained during school than they had time to recover to fund their retirement. As parents, guardians and grandparents, we often have this desire to support and help our children. We want them to be successful and are willing to go above and beyond to do so.
